    B20A3 - 88-89 Prelude
    B20A5 - 88-91 Prelude
    B20A - 88-91 Japanese Prelude
    B20A - 86-87 Japanese Prelude (might have been on 83-85 also), Japanese 3g Accord
    B20B(#?) -99(i think) CRV
    B20Z(#?) 00+ CRV

    the 2 B20A engines are not the same.... most places will carry the b20a from a 3g prelude, not the 2g lude/3g accord version

    I'm not sure on the Euro market engines, so i can't verify B20A2 and B20A7, although it wouldn't suprise me...

    as a general rule, the numbers are added on for the US market... although i believe that the Integra Type-R's had a number at the end, JDM or not...

    Realy B20A2 and B20A7 are Euromarket 3rd gen accord engines, diference between them - B20A7 with catalitic converter and oxygen sensor (little beat less power), B20A2 - without catalitic 'n' without oxygen sensor (makes 101 kW@6k rpm,
